District Coordinator- Phalombe and Thyolo Districts
Reporting to: Program Managers- FOCCAD and WORI
Responsibilities
- Coordinating AGYW programing using combination HIV prevention
- Coordinating and supporting management of teen clubs for children/ adolescents living with HIV in targeted health facilities.
- Managing targeted community HIV testing for AGYW
- Support school and community based AGYW programing through life skills and CSE
- Facilitate defaulter tracing and treatment adherence for AGYW
- Manage referral systems for quality HIV services for AGYW
- Support monitoring and supervision for AGYW peer education activities.
- Coordinate economic empowerment activities for AGYW living with HIV
- Support business mentorship for AGYW on school bursaries.
Qualifications:
- Degree in public health, Nursing or Social Sciences
- Strong knowledge and practice of essential health package and delivery models for combination prevention (biomedical and behavioral)
- Knowledge and practice on key health policies for Malawi
- Knowledge in working with key populations in HIV and AIDS programing.
- Hands on experience on peer education programing on HTS, ART, PMTCT, EID, and general HIV and AIDS prevention programing focusing on AGYW
- Strong planning and managerial skills
- Computer skills a MUST.
